Journal: The Journal of neuroscience : the official journal of the Society for Neuroscience

Article Title: Tissue-Type Plasminogen Activator Regulates the Neuronal Uptake of Glucose in the Ischemic Brain

doi: 10.1523/JNEUROSCI.1241-12.2012

Figure Lengend Snippet: A. Experimental design used to study the effect of tPA on neuronal survival. Letters denote time of treatment with tPA after exposure to oxygen-glucose deprivation (OGD) conditions. B – D. Mean cell survival (panels B & C) and release of LDH into the culture media (panel D) in Wt cerebral cortical neurons treated with 5 nM of proteolytically active (panels B & D) or inactive tPA (itPA; panels C & D), or 10 nM of plasmin (panel C), 5, or 30, or 60, or 120, or 180, or 360 minutes after exposure to 55 minutes of OGD conditions. n = 20 in B and 15 in C and D. * in B: p < 0.05 compared to neurons exposed to OGD conditions without subsequent treatment with tPA. * in C: p < 0.05 compared to neurons left untreated after exposure to OGD conditions. Ns: non-significant. * in D: p < 0.05 compared to cells exposed to OGD conditions without subsequent treatment. Lines denote SD. E. Mean cell survival in Wt cerebral cortical neurons exposed to 55 minutes of OGD conditions and treated 1 hour later with 5 nM of tPA, alone or in combination with either 10 µM of MK-801 or 60 nM of the receptor associated protein (RAP), or 100 nM of the tyrosine kinase receptor B (TrkB) inhibitor K-252a. n = 10. * p < 0.05 compared to neurons treated with tPA alone, or with a combination of tPA and K-252a. Lines denote SD. F. Mean volume of the ischemic lesion in Wt and Plg−/− mice treated one hour after tMCAO with saline solution (white bars) or rtPA 1 – 9 mg/Kg/IV (gray bars). n = 10 per group. * p < 0.05 compared to Wt mice treated with saline solution. ** p < 0.05 compared to mice treated with 1 mg/Kg/IV of rtPA. *** p < 0.05 compared to Plg−/− mice treated with saline solution. Bars depict mean volume of the ischemic lesion in mm3. Lines denote SD.

Article Snippet: Other reagents were human recombinant tissue-type plasminogen activator (Genentech Inc.), the phosphoinositide (PI) 3-kinase/Akt inhibitor Wortmannin, methanol, methyl salicylate and triphenyltetrazolium chloride (Sigma Aldrich), the 3-(4,5- Dimethylthiazol -2-yl)-2,5-di phenyl tetrazolium bromide (MTT) assay (ATCC), the LDH release assay (Roche), the Receptor-Associated Protein (RAP; kindly provided by Dr. Dudley K. Strickland, University of Maryland), the NMDAR antagonist MK-801 (Tocris Bioscience), rapamycin and the TrkB inhibitor K-252a (Calbiochem), HIF-1α shRNA, scramble shRNA lentiviral particles, anti-GLUT3 antibodies and TRITC-conjugated donkey anti-goat IgG (Santa Cruz Biotechnology), anti-HIF-1α antibodies (Abcam), antibodies against the p70S6 kinase (p70 S6K ) phosphorylated at Thr389 (Cell Signaling), heparin sodium (Abraxis Pharmaceutical Products), blue latex (Connecticut Valley Biological Supply), ApopTag Plus Fluorescein in Situ Apoptosis Detection Kit (Chemicon International), 4'-6-Diamidino-2-phenylindole (DAPI; Invitrogen), triphenyltetrazolium chloride (TTC; Sigma-Aldrich), 2- N -(7-nitrobenz-2-oxa-1,3-diazol-4-yl)amino)-2-deoxyglucose (2-NBDG; Molecular Probes), and 18-Fluorodeoxyglucose (PETNET).

Journal: Journal of Neuroinflammation

Article Title: BDNF promotes activation of astrocytes and microglia contributing to neuroinflammation and mechanical allodynia in cyclophosphamide-induced cystitis

doi: 10.1186/s12974-020-1704-0

Figure Lengend Snippet: Changes in the mechanical threshold after antagonist administration. a Compared to the CYP + DMSO groups, ANA-12 (0.5 mg/kg), and ANA-12 (1.0 mg/kg) treated every other day after CYP injection reduced the decrease in the mechanical threshold and accelerated recovery significantly, while there was no difference between ANA-12 (0.1 mg/kg) and CYP + DMSO group. There was difference between ANA-12 (0.5 mg/kg) and ANA-12 (1.0 mg/kg) only at day 7, day 10, day 13. b Compared to the CYP+DMSO groups, ANA-12 (0.5 mg/kg), and K252a treated every other day after CYP injection reduced the decrease of the mechanical threshold and accelerated recovery significantly, and there was no difference between the effects of ANA-12 (0.5 mg/kg) and K252a. c ANA-12 treated next day after the third CYP injection 3 days continuously could reverse the mechanical threshold rapidly. d ANA-12 treated one day prior to CYP injection could prevent the onset of allodynia; moreover, there was no significant difference when compared with the control group. All data were analyzed using a two-way analysis of variance (ANOVA) followed by the Sidak's multiple comparisons test. All data were calculated as mean ± SEM ( n = 10 per group). * p < 0.05, ** p < 0.01, *** p < 0.001 vs. the control group. # p < 0.05, ## p < 0.01, ### p < 0.001 vs. the CYP + DMSO group. && p < 0.01, &&& p < 0.001 vs. the ANA-12 (0.5mg/kg) group

Article Snippet: K252a (2 μg/10 μL/rat; #12754, Cell Signaling Technology), injected intrathecally (i.t.), was dissolved in 10% DMSO [ ].

Article Title: Actions of brain-derived neurotrophic factor on evoked and spontaneous EPSCs dissociate with maturation of neurones cultured from rat visual cortex

doi: 10.1111/j.1469-7793.2000.t01-1-00579.x

Figure Lengend Snippet: A, to the left is shown the time course of the frequency of mEPSCs. The frequency was measured every 30 s. BDNF and K252a were applied to this cell at 200 ng ml−1 and 200 nm, respectively, during the periods indicated by horizontal bars. To the right are shown cumulative plots of the amplitude distributions of mEPSCs 2–5 min before (continuous line) and 17–20 min after (dotted line) the BDNF application. Bin width is 2 pA. The total number of events before and after the BDNF application is 572 and 587, respectively. Other conventions are the same as in Fig. 1D. B, to the left is shown the time course of the frequency of mEPSCs. BDNF and anti-BDNF antibody were applied to this cell at 200 ng ml−1 and 5 μg ml−1, respectively, during the periods indicated by the horizontal bars. To the right are shown cumulative plots of the amplitude distributions of mEPSCs 2–5 min before (continuous line) and 17–20 min after (dotted line) the BDNF application. The total number of events is 452 and 464, respectively. Other conventions are the same as in Fig. 1D.

Article Snippet: Application of BDNF and drugs In most of the experiments, recombinant human BDNF (provided from Sumitomo Pharmaceutical Co., Ltd, Japan), or K252a (Kyowa Hakko Co., Ltd, Japan) was applied to neurones through the perfusion medium 10–15 min after the initiation of recordings.
